Praslin, the second-largest island in Seychelles, is a paradise renowned for its stunning beaches, lush tropical landscapes, and vibrant Creole culture. With its crystal-clear waters and rich biodiversity, travelers flock here to experience the breathtaking beauty of Anse Lazio and indulge in delectable local cuisine, all while soaking up the laid-back island vibe.

✨ Things to Do

Snorkeling at Anse Lazio: Engage in snorkeling adventures at Anse Lazio, where you can observe colorful marine life in crystal-clear waters. It's a favorite spot for both beginners and experienced snorkelers.

Coco de Mer Nature Reserve Tour: Explore the Coco de Mer Nature Reserve, home to the world’s largest nut. Visitors can take guided walks through lush forests and learn about unique flora and fauna.

Island Hopping Excursion: Discover nearby islands like Curieuse and St. Pierre on an island hopping tour from Praslin. Enjoy swimming, snorkeling, and sunbathing on pristine beaches.

Vallée de Mai National Park: A UNESCO World Heritage site, Vallée de Mai offers a glimpse into Seychelles' natural habitat. Visitor Tip: Visit early in the morning for better wildlife sightings.

Anse Georgette: This secluded beach is known for its soft white sands and turquoise waters. Visitors can enjoy swimming and picnicking in a tranquil setting.

Curieuse Island: Famous for its giant tortoises, Curieuse Island allows visitors to explore nature trails and observe wildlife up close.

Travel Tips for Praslin

💡 Essential Logistics & Insider Tips for Praslin

🚆 Getting Around

The Core Tip: Most visitors rely on taxis and rental cars to navigate Praslin, as public transit options are limited.

The Pro Move: Consider renting a car to explore the island at your own pace, ensuring access to less crowded beaches like Anse Georgette.

📅 Timing Your Trip

The Core Tip: The peak travel season typically spans from May to September, coinciding with dry weather and pleasant temperatures.

The Pro Move: Visit popular spots like Vallee de Mai early in the morning to enjoy a quieter experience before larger crowds arrive.

🚶 Getting Around Safely

The Core Tip: Praslin is relatively walkable, particularly around tourist areas, making it easy to explore local markets and beaches.

The Pro Move: Stick to well-lit paths when walking after dark, especially near less populated areas like Anse Volbert.

💳 Money & Payments

The Core Tip: Most hotels, restaurants, and attractions accept credit cards, but some small vendors may prefer cash transactions.

The Pro Move: Keep a small amount of Seychellois Rupees handy for local markets or street food stalls that may not accept cards.

✈️ Airport / Arrival Tips

The Core Tip: Arriving at Praslin Island is typically done via small planes from Mahé or by ferry; taxis are available upon arrival.

The Pro Move: Follow airport signage to designated taxi areas for quicker transport to your accommodation, especially during peak hours.
